I ordered a new computer for university, here's the specs I went with.

Dimension 8300: Pentium 4 Processor at 2.60GHz w/800MHz front side bus/ HT Technology
Memory: Free Upgrade from 256MB to 512MB DDR SDRAM at 400MHz
Keyboard: Dell Quietkey Keyboard - English
Monitors: Dell 19" M992 (17.90" V.I.S.) Monitor
Video Card: New 128MB DDR ATI RADEON 9800 Graphics Card with TV-Out and DVI
Hard Drive: 120GB Ultra ATA-100 Hard Drive
Floppy Drive and Additional Storage Devices: 64MB Dell USB Memory Key and Floppy Drive
Operating System: Microsoft Windows XP Professional
Mouse: Dell 2-button scroll mouse
Network Interface Card: Integrated Intel PRO 10/100 Ethernet
Modem: 56K PCI Telephony Modem
Primary CD/DVD/CD-RW Drive: 16 Max DVD-ROM Drive
Sound Card: SoundBlaster Live! 5.1 Digital Sound Card
Speakers: Harman Kardon HK-395 Speakers with Subwoofer
CD/DVD/CD-RW Drive, 2nd Bay: 48x/24x/48x CD-RW Drive

I think I'm going to be happy with this machine :D
